Accounting Policies: The accompanying schedule of expenditures of federal awards (the “Schedule”) includes the federal
award activity of South Peninsula Hospital under programs of the federal government for the year
ended June 30, 2023. The information in this Schedule is presented in accordance with the
requirements of Title 2 U.S. Code of Federal Regulations Part 200, Uniform Administrative
Requirements, Cost Principles, and Audit Requirements for Federal Awards (Uniform Guidance).
Because the Schedule presents only a selected portion of the operations of South Peninsula Hospital,
it is not intended to and does not present the financial position, changes in net position or cash
flows of South Peninsula Hospital. Expenditures reported on the Schedule are reported on the accrual basis of accounting. Such
expenditures are recognized following the cost principles contained in the Uniform Guidance,
wherein certain types of expenditures are not allowable or are limited as to reimbursement.
De Minimis Rate Used: N
Rate Explanation: South Peninsula Hospital has elected not to use the 10-percent de minimis indirect cost rate allowed
under the Uniform Guidance.
The total PRF Program expenditures on the Schedule includes $3,118,212 of lost revenues which are
reported in accordance with the terms and conditions included in the Health Resources and Services
Administration (HRSA) Post-Payment Notice of Reporting Requirements specific to the PRF Program.
